- Abstract
The background of this study revolves around the cultivation, processing, and nutrient analysis of three specific green leafy vegetables: Palak (spinach), Amaranthus tristis (tropical amaranth) and Drumstick leaves. Green leafy vegetables are widely recognized for their nutritional value, being rich sources of vitamins, minerals and antioxidants. However, the preservation of these nutrients during processing, particularly drying methods is a critical aspect that can affect the overall nutritional quality of the vegetables. The findings reveal a rich content of key nutrients, underscoring the significance of microgreens as a valuable dietary source. This research contributes valuable insights into the nutritional composition of microgreens, emphasizing their potential role in promoting overall health and well-being.
